THE HORSE AND HIS BOY
Book • 1954
The story follows Shasta, a young boy living in the southern land of Calormen, who discovers a talking horse named Bree.
Together, they escape north towards Narnia, joined by another talking horse, Hwin, and her rider, Aravis.
Along their journey, they uncover a plot by the Calormene prince to attack Narnia and must warn the King of Archenland and the rulers of Narnia.
The tale is filled with adventure, moral lessons, and the guidance of the lion Aslan, who plays a pivotal role in their journey.
